转载: MySQL配置文件my.cnf 详解:#BEGIN CONFIG INFO#DESCR: 4GB RAM, 只使用InnoDB, ACID, 少量的连接, 队列负载大#TYPE: SYSTEM#END CONFIG INFO ## 此mysql配置文件例子针对4G内存。 # 主要使用INNO ...
分类:
数据库 时间:
2017-09-14 16:33:58
阅读次数:
179
登录MySQL:mysql -uroot -p密码 退出MySQL:exit | quit 查看数据库:show databases; ...
分类:
数据库 时间:
2017-09-14 16:34:43
阅读次数:
171
一、介绍角色就是相关权限的命令集合,使用角色的主要目的就是为了简化权限的管理。假定有用户a,b,c为了让他们都拥有如下权限1. 连接数据库2. 在scott.emp表上select,insert,update。如果采用直接授权操作,则需要进行12次授权。因为要进行12次授权操作,所以比较麻烦喔!怎么 ...
分类:
数据库 时间:
2017-09-14 16:34:57
阅读次数:
157
创建、删除唯一约束: db2 "alter table tabname add unique(colname)" db2 "alter table tabname drop unique CONSTNAME " 创建主键约束: db2 "alter table staff add primary k ...
分类:
数据库 时间:
2017-09-14 16:39:50
阅读次数:
357
存储过程用于执行特定的操作,当建立存储过程时,既可以指定输入参数(in),也可以指定输出参数(out),通过在过程中使用输入参数,可以将数据传递到执行部分;通过使用输出参数,可以将执行部分的数据传递到应用环境。在sqlplus中可以使用create procedure命令来建立过程。实例如下:1.请 ...
分类:
数据库 时间:
2017-09-14 16:41:08
阅读次数:
250
前些天拿到一个表,将近有4000w数据,没有任何索引,主键。(建这表的绝对是个人才) 这是一个日志表,记录了游戏中物品的产出与消耗,原先有一个后台对这个表进行统计。。。。。(这要用超级计算机才能统计得出来吧),只能帮前人填坑了。。。。 数据太大,决定用分区来重构。 如果你发现是empty,说明你的m ...
分类:
数据库 时间:
2017-09-14 16:41:17
阅读次数:
188
一、定义: 多表查询包括二张表以上的表的查询,其中有内连拉、左外、右外连接的查询 二、数据准备 三、内连接 查询两张表中都有的关联数据,相当于利用条件从笛卡尔积结果中筛选出了正确的结果。 SELECT * FROM emp,dep WHERE emp.dep_id=dep.id; 或 SELECT ...
分类:
数据库 时间:
2017-09-14 16:42:01
阅读次数:
204
mysql 链接服务器 mysql -h localhost -u root -p * show databases 显示数据库 * use dbname 选择数据库 * show tables 显示数据表 *create database 数据库名 建库 * drop database dbnam... ...
分类:
数据库 时间:
2017-09-14 16:42:11
阅读次数:
181
一、概念表空间是数据库的逻辑组成部分。从物理上讲,数据库数据存放在数据文件中;从逻辑上讲,数据库数据则是存放在表空间中,表空间由一个或多个数据文件组成。 二、数据库的逻辑结构oracle中逻辑结构包括表空间、段、区和块。说明一下数据库由表空间构成,而表空间又是由段构成,而段又是由区构成,而区又是由o ...
分类:
数据库 时间:
2017-09-14 16:42:17
阅读次数:
192
一、建立表时候,注意PCTFREE参数的作用 PCTFREE:为一个块保留的空间百分比,表示数据块在什么情况下可以被insert,默认是10,表示当数据块的可用空间低于10%后,就不可以被insert了,只能被用于update;即:当使用一个block时,在达到pctfree之前,该block是一直 ...
分类:
数据库 时间:
2017-09-14 16:43:16
阅读次数:
110
定义: 完整性约束是对字段进行限制,从而符合该字段达到我们期望的效果比如字段含有默认值,不能是NULL等, 主要有唯一、自增、主键、外键约束 唯一约束: 唯一约束可以有多个但索引列的值必须唯一,索引列的值允许有空值。 如果能确定某个数据列将只包含彼此各不相同的值,在为这个数据列创建索引的时候就应该使 ...
分类:
数据库 时间:
2017-09-14 16:43:33
阅读次数:
229
本篇内容 一、 MySQL概述 MySQL是一个关系型数据库管理系统,由瑞典 MySQL AB 公司开发,目前属于 Oracle 旗下公司。MySQL 最流行的关系型数据库管理系统,在 WEB 应用方面 MySQL 是最好的 RDBMS (Relational Database Management ...
分类:
数据库 时间:
2017-09-14 16:45:03
阅读次数:
132
一、IDE工具介绍 二、MySQL数据备份 1.使用mysqldump实现逻辑备份 2.恢复逻辑备份 3.在不进入数据库的情况下查看数据库内的数据 4.数据库迁移(扩展了解) 5.表的导出和导入 ...
分类:
数据库 时间:
2017-09-14 16:46:18
阅读次数:
158
在mysql中,round函数用于数据的四舍五入,它有两种形式: 1、round(x,d) ,x指要处理的数,d是指保留几位小数 这里有个值得注意的地方是,d可以是负数,这时是指定小数点左边的d位整数位为0,同时小数位均为0; 2、round(x) ,其实就是round(x,0),也就是默认d为0; ...
分类:
数据库 时间:
2017-09-14 16:46:33
阅读次数:
216
mysql主从同步: 1.为什么要主从同步? 在Web应用系统中,数据库性能是导致系统性能瓶颈最主要的原因之一。尤其是在大规模系统中,数据库集群已经成为必备的配置之一。集群的好处主要有:查询负载、数据库复制备份等。其中Master负责写操作的负载,也就是说一切写的操作都在Master上进行,而读的操 ...
分类:
数据库 时间:
2017-09-14 16:46:48
阅读次数:
214
一、管理索引-原理介绍索引是用于加速数据存取的数据对象。合理的使用索引可以大大降低i/o次数,从而提高数据访问性能。索引有很多种我们主要介绍常用的几种:为什么添加了索引后,会加快查询速度呢? 二、创建索引1)、单列索引单列索引是基于单个列所建立的索引语法:create index 索引名 on 表名 ...
分类:
数据库 时间:
2017-09-14 16:47:37
阅读次数:
127
系统环境为server2012 1、下载mysql解压版,解压安装包到指定目录 2、在以上目录中,复制一份my-default.ini文件,重命名为my.ini,进行如下修改(按照需要): 3、添加环境变量,将C:\Program Files\mysql\bin添加到系统的环境变量Path中 4、在 ...
分类:
数据库 时间:
2017-09-14 16:48:29
阅读次数:
207
一、无返回值的存储过程 古人云:欲速则不达,为了让大家伙比较容易接受分页过程编写,我还是从简单到复杂,循序渐进的给大家讲解。首先是掌握最简单的存储过程,无返回值的存储过程。 案例:现有一张表book,表结构如下:书号、书名、出版社。 CREATE TABLE book( ID NUMBER(4), ...
分类:
数据库 时间:
2017-09-14 16:48:42
阅读次数:
179
包用于在逻辑上组合过程和函数,它由包规范和包体两部分组成。1)、我们可以使用create package命令来创建包,如:i、创建一个包sp_packageii、声明该包有一个过程update_saliii、声明该包有一个函数annual_income 2)、建立包体可以使用create packa ...
分类:
数据库 时间:
2017-09-14 16:49:17
阅读次数:
201
如何采用mysql内置函数获取指定时间之前的日期呢? SELECT something FROM table_name WHERE DATE_SUB(CURDATE(),INTERVAL 30 DAY) <= date_col; 获取30天前的日期。 select date_sub(now(),in ...
分类:
数据库 时间:
2017-09-14 16:49:32
阅读次数:
294